Understanding the Basics: Types of Blinds

Before diving into the selection process, it's essential to understand the various types of blinds available:

  • Vertical Blinds: Ideal for patio doors and large windows, their vertical slats offer excellent light control and are easy to operate.

  • Venetian Blinds: Composed of horizontal slats that can be adjusted for privacy and light, Venetian blinds are versatile and fit most standard windows.

  • Roller Blinds: These blinds offer a minimalistic look, rolling up or down, and are excellent for achieving a sleek and modern aesthetic.

  • Roman Blinds: Known for their soft fabric folds, Roman blinds combine the functionality of traditional blinds with the soft appearance of curtains.


Room-by-Room Selection

Living Room

The living room is the heart of your home—a space to entertain guests and relax with family—making light control and privacy essential. Roman blinds offer the perfect blend of style and practicality, adding a touch of sophistication without sacrificing function. Their soft, layered design diffuses natural light beautifully, creating a warm and inviting ambiance that enhances your living room’s comfort and charm.


Kitchen

In the kitchen, practicality and low maintenance are essential. Faux wood Venetian blinds offer the perfect blend of function and style, resisting moisture while being incredibly easy to clean. Their warm, natural aesthetic enhances the space, while the adjustable slats give you precise control over sunlight during the day and ensure privacy at night.


Bedroom

Privacy and light control are essential for any bedroom. Blackout roller blinds are an excellent choice, effectively blocking early morning light while maintaining your privacy. Available in a variety of patterns and textures, they offer both functionality and an opportunity to personalize your private retreat.


Bathroom

For bathrooms, where privacy and humidity are key considerations, vinyl roller blinds and faux wood Venetian blinds are excellent choices. Designed to resist moisture and prevent warping, these materials offer long-lasting durability while maintaining their functionality and style.


Home Office

A well-designed home office strikes the perfect balance between natural light and minimal glare, essential for those long hours at the computer. Venetian blinds provide exceptional control over both light and privacy, helping to minimize screen glare while fostering a comfortable, productive workspace.


Design Considerations

When selecting blinds, take your room's overall design and color scheme into account. Neutral tones offer versatility, effortlessly complementing any decor. For a bolder approach, opt for blinds that either contrast with your primary color palette or align with your accent hues. Texture is equally important—wooden blinds bring warmth and depth, metal blinds deliver a sleek, modern edge, and fabric blinds provide a soft, elegant touch that pairs beautifully with upholstered furniture and other textiles. Choose the option that enhances both the style and ambiance of your space.
